Requirements
You must:
- identify all Key Principals Key PrincipalsPerson who controls and/or manages the Borrower or the Property, is critical to the successful operation and management of the Borrower and the Property, and/or may be required to provide a Guaranty. and Principals PrincipalsPerson who owns or controls, in the aggregate, directly or indirectly (together with that Person's Immediate Family Members, if an individual), specified interests in the Borrower per Part I, Chapter 3: Borrower, Guarantor, Key Principals, and Principals, Section 303: Key Principals, Principals,… of the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. and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. ;
- confirm the original underwriting of the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. ,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. , and each Key Principal Key PrincipalPerson who controls and/or manages the Borrower or the Property, is critical to the successful operation and management of the Borrower and the Property, and/or may be required to provide a Guaranty. and Principal PrincipalPerson who owns or controls, in the aggregate, directly or indirectly (together with that Person's Immediate Family Members, if an individual), specified interests in the Borrower per Part I, Chapter 3: Borrower, Guarantor, Key Principals, and Principals, Section 303: Key Principals, Principals,… per Part I, Chapter 3: Borrower, Guarantor, Key Principals, and Principals ;
- obtain updates to the:
- financial statements for all parties relevant to the transaction;
- Multifamily Underwriting Certificates ( Form 6460 series ) for the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. ,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. , and each Key Principal Key PrincipalPerson who controls and/or manages the Borrower or the Property, is critical to the successful operation and management of the Borrower and the Property, and/or may be required to provide a Guaranty. ;
- organizational documents of the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. ,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. , and each Key Principal Key PrincipalPerson who controls and/or manages the Borrower or the Property, is critical to the successful operation and management of the Borrower and the Property, and/or may be required to provide a Guaranty. ; and
- good standing certificate from the jurisdiction where an entity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. and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. are organized;
- confirm that the organizational structure of the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. ,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. , and each Key Principal Key PrincipalPerson who controls and/or manages the Borrower or the Property, is critical to the successful operation and management of the Borrower and the Property, and/or may be required to provide a Guaranty. complies with Part I, Chapter 3: Borrower, Guarantor, Key Principals, and Principals ; and
- confirm that no unauthorized change has been made to the organizational structure or organizational documents of the Borrower BorrowerPerson who is the obligor per the Note. or the Guarantor GuarantorKey Principal or other Person executing a Payment Guaranty, Non-Recourse Guaranty, or any other Mortgage Loan guaranty. .
